Output 577818385ce6d9be13254a35dd39f312ae7cf1fb9e47adb0099e15dbf2d4607c:1

value
29991421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f606c7cfba235544230a70ba98c2c7d81c1a17 OP_EQUAL
address
2MuXCw7D28RENPE1UdxoCkyxnEfLTCi41A6
transaction
577818385ce6d9be13254a35dd39f312ae7cf1fb9e47adb0099e15dbf2d4607c